În perioada 11-14 mai 2017, la sediul Fundației Dacica din satul Alun, comuna Boșorod, jud. Hunedoara, a avut loc Colocviul Internațional de Arheologie Funerară „Funerary Practices at the Thracians and Celts in the Second Iron Age”, organizat de International Union for Prehistoric and Protohistoric Sciences în colaborare cu Centrul de Studii al Fundației Dacica, Asociația de Studii pentru Arheologie Funerară – Romania și Muzeul „Carol I” Brăila.

Au participat specialiști din 10 țări (România, Republica Moldova, Bulgaria, Ungaria, Slovenia, Slovacia, Polonia, Italia, Elveția și Spania).
